Description

This particular gene is responsible for producing a crucial enzyme called UDP-glucuronosyltransferase. This enzyme plays a major role in the glucuronidation pathway by converting various small lipophilic molecules, including steroids, bilirubin, hormones, and drugs, into water-soluble metabolites that can be easily excreted from the body. Interestingly, this gene is part of a complex locus that encompasses multiple UDP-glucuronosyltransferases.
Within this locus, there are thirteen distinct alternate first exons, along with four common exons. Unfortunately, four of these alternate first exons are classified as pseudogenes and do not contribute to the final protein product. However, the remaining nine first exons can undergo splicing with the four common exons, resulting in the formation of nine proteins that have diverse N-termini but share identical C-termini.
Each alternate first exon encodes a specific substrate binding site and possesses its own promoter, thereby enabling individual regulation of each enzyme variant. Although this UDP-glucuronosyltransferase does exhibit some degree of glucuronidase activity towards bilirubin, its primary function lies in the efficient metabolism of amines, steroids, and sapogenins.

Target

Background

UDPGT is of major importance in the conjugation and subsequent elimination of potentially toxic xenobiotics and endogenous compounds. This isoform glucuronidates bilirubin IX-alpha to form both the IX-alpha-C8 and IX-alpha-C12 monoconjugates and diconjugate. Isoform 2 lacks transferase activity but acts as a negative regulator of isoform 1 (By similarity).

Tissue specificityIsoform 1 and isoform 2 are expressed in liver, kidney, colon and small intestine. Isoform 2 but not isoform 1 is expressed in esophagus. Not expressed in skin.
Celluar localizationEndoplasmic reticulum;
